UC Davis vs. Design Institute of San Diego
Both University of California-Davis and Design Institute of San Diego are 4 years schools located in California. The following statements compare University of California-Davis and Design Institute of San Diego with important academic statistics including tuition, test scores, and admission rate.
- UC Davis's tuition ($46,024) is more expensive than Design Institute of San Diego ($29,350).
- UC Davis's acceptance rate (37.34%) is lower than Design Institute of San Diego (100.00%).
- Design Institute of San Diego has higher yield (100.00%) than UC Davis (18.09%).
- Design Institute of San Diego's students to faculty ratio (7 to 1) is lower than UC Davis (21 to 1).
- UC Davis (39,679 students) is larger than Design Institute of San Diego (101 students) with more enrolled students.
- UC Davis ($20,054) has higher amount of financial aid than Design Institute of San Diego ($6,360).
- UC Davis's graduation rate (86%) is higher than Design Institute of San Diego (75%).
